Charities and non-profits face unique SEO challenges around limited budgets, mission-driven content that must rank against commercial competitors, and the need to capture donation-intent searches alongside awareness queries. Google Ad Grants provide free advertising but organic SEO determines long-term visibility. Non-profits must also leverage their natural advantage in earning backlinks from media, government, and educational institutions.
for Charities & Non-profits SEO tips
- Apply for Google Ad Grants to supplement organic efforts with free PPC while building the domain authority that sustains long-term organic rankings.
- Create impact report pages with specific statistics and beneficiary stories since these earn media backlinks and demonstrate the credibility Google rewards.
- Target cause-specific keywords like "how to help [cause]" and "donate to [cause] UK" with dedicated landing pages optimised for donation conversions.
Why internal linking is the fastest SEO win most sites ignore
PageRank flows through internal links
Every page on your site has a PageRank value. Internal links act as pipes that distribute that value across your site. Pages with strong internal link profiles consistently rank higher - even against competing pages with similar backlink profiles. It is one of the few levers entirely within your control.
Crawler coverage and index depth
Googlebot follows links to discover content. Pages that are only reachable through deep navigation or sitemaps get crawled less frequently and indexed less reliably. Contextual internal links from high-traffic or high-authority pages pull new or thin pages into Google's main index faster.
Topical authority = better AI citation
Site structure signals topical authority to both Google and AI systems. When your keyword clusters are well-linked - pillar pages linking to cluster pages and vice versa - it creates a clear, crawlable map of your expertise. AI citation and featured snippet systems prefer sources with deep, interconnected coverage of a topic.
Internal linking best practices
Avoid "click here" or "read more". Use the topic the page covers - "SEO audit checklist" beats "this article" every time.
Links placed in the first 20% of a page body pass more equity and get higher clickthrough rates.
When B links to A, A should often link back to B. Bidirectional linking reinforces topical clusters.
Your comprehensive guides (pillars) should link to all related cluster pages. Cluster pages should link back to the pillar.
If every link to a page uses exact-match anchor text it looks manipulative. Vary your phrasing naturally.
Pages with zero internal links are crawled rarely and rarely rank. Use site: searches or your CMS to find and fix them.
